Planet Fitness in Smyrna, TN, offers a convenient 24-hour gym experience with a range of well-maintained fitness equipment. Members, especially Black Card holders, benefit from perks such as tanning, massage chairs, and hydrotherapy beds. The gym is frequently praised for its friendly and helpful staff who create a welcoming atmosphere.

Despite the positive points, cleanliness remains a significant concern. Many reviews point out that the bathrooms and locker rooms are often filthy, and maintenance issues with equipment are recurring. While some find the judgement-free environment appealing, others find the lack of heavy lifting options limiting.
